Ingredients:

  • 4 ounces Bacardi Light Rum
  • 3 ounces Fresh lime juice
  • 1/4 cup water
  • 3 cups diet sprite
  • 12 fresh mint leaves
  • 3 cups ice

Directions:

  1. Combine all ingredients in a blender.
  2. Pulse until mixture is smooth and slushy. Pour slushy mixture into Popsicle molds.
  3. Add Popsicle sticks and freeze for 8 hours.
